What is the photographer's style and how does it align with my vision?
Photography styles include portrait, landscape, and photojournalism. Look at the photographer's portfolio to understand their style. In the Philippines, beautiful landscapes might be captured in a natural and candid way. Ensure their work matches the look and feel you want for your project.
How experienced is the photographer in my project's niche?
Check if the photographer has worked on projects similar to yours. For a wedding in Manila, choose someone experienced in capturing special moments at big events. Ask for past examples to gauge their skill and fit.
What deliverables will the photographer provide?
Decide if you need digital copies, prints, or a combination. Agree on how many photos you will receive and in what format. This is important to ensure you get exactly what you need from the photo session.
How will the photographer handle location challenges in the Philippines?
The weather can be unpredictable in places like Cebu. Ask how they have adapted in similar situations. A good photographer will have strategies to work around local challenges to capture stunning shots.
What is the expected timeline for the project?
Understand how long the photographer needs to edit and deliver the final images. This sets clear expectations and helps in planning the release or use of the photos for your project. Agree on milestones if it's a long project.
Will the photographer need specific equipment or permits?
Some locations, like popular beaches or historical sites in the Philippines, might require permits. The photographer should know what equipment fits the job and if special permissions are needed. This avoids issues on the scheduled day.
How will changes in the project be handled?
Sometimes projects change direction. It's important to understand how flexible the photographer is with changes. Discuss how changes might affect timelines and deliverables to ensure everyone stays on the same page.
Is the photographer accessible for communication throughout the project?
Regular updates and check-ins help keep the project on track. Determine the best way to communicate, be it email, phone, or chat. This fosters a good relationship and ensures smooth progress.
Can the photographer provide references or testimonials?
It's reassuring to hear from past clients about their working experience with the photographer. Testimonials can offer insight into reliability and professionalism. This can boost your confidence in your hiring decision.
What is the photographer's policy on model or location releases?
Understand if there are specific legal requirements the photographer follows. In the Philippines, this might be pertinent for photographing in certain communities. Proper releases ensure all parties are comfortable using the images.
